Output cd7efdacd20b6add584540c44296a70d3035b2454a30270e84ad17ccc436638d:15

value
40000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e34e8cec9412cd7f9ca45f1de394a57bcaea7ce OP_EQUAL
address
34SjaWTAiXHknj14QXraPAm44DJvtEGQ1M
transaction
cd7efdacd20b6add584540c44296a70d3035b2454a30270e84ad17ccc436638d
spent
true